CC -!- FUNCTION: Essential cell division protein that coordinates cell
CC division and chromosome segregation. The N-terminus is involved in
CC assembly of the cell-division machinery. The C-terminus functions as a
CC DNA motor that moves dsDNA in an ATP-dependent manner towards the dif
CC recombination site, which is located within the replication terminus
CC region. Required for activation of the Xer recombinase, allowing
CC activation of chromosome unlinking by recombination.
